    Changing arrow spine?

    Recently got a new to me bow, 2017 Bowtech Prodigy. Got a few questions, currently its set right at 60# with 30.5" draw, bow rated up to 70#. Right now, drawing the bow isn't an issue. However, im noticing some performance issues when I start to shoot past 35 yards. Noticing the arrow arrow has a bit of a wobble, so assuming thats a spine issue. Currently shooting GoldTip Hunter XT .340 with 100gr tip cut right at 29.5. So not sure if I should crank draw weight up 3-4# and change arrows, or try and just change the arrow?

    #2
    Never hurts to get a stiffer arrow. It could just be out of tune as well, shoot through paper

      #3
      Sounds like more of a bow setup issue as the spine would seem to be correct, I'd suggest a tune, CCR or others.

          #5
          Originally posted by Abu_dude View Post
          I would have to agree here but stiffer spine will never hurt. you are probably near the top end of the 340 window
          So went and picked up some 300s and it was the spine, i was right on the edge of 340 and now im shooting dead on
